My son is in Primary Five and doesn’t seem to take any interest in world affairs. I try to encourage him to read the newspaper and watch the news on television with me, but he’d rather play video games or watch television. Any ideas?
Computers and other electronic entertainment media have a very strong pull on children and can easily distract them from other interests. Research tells us that the pros and cons of spending a lot of time with them are complex and vary by the individual. In the short term, at least, you could limit your son’s time in front of a screen so that he has the opportunity to take an interest in other things.
